Having quickly become one of the top BLUES acts performing in The Great Pacific Northwest, Becki Sue & her Big Rockin' Daddies! commands attention by "bringing it" to each and every show... and, yes, the exclamation point is part of the band name.

The music on this CD, captured "live" at The Seattle Drum School's recording studio that also contains a small, 60 to 70-seat concert theatre called The Little Auditorium in Back (The L.A.B.), showcases the multi-talented aspects of the band; from Becki Sue's sassy, "in-your-face" vocal delivery; to Tom "T-Boy Neal" Boyle's Washington Blues Society award-winning (2003, 2005 and 2006) Texas & Chicago-style "blast furnace" electric guitar work; to Jim King's awesome "triple threat" tenor sax/blues harp/vocal combination; to Les "WildChild" White's (upright all night bass) & Jeff Hayes' (drums) "nailed-to-the-floor" rhythm section work.

The band has received several regional blues awards and nominations, including being the ONLY band to be nominated by both The Washington Blues Society and The Seattle Weekly Newspaper in their respective "Best Blues Band" categories for 2005.

In 2006 the band was nominated for a record 15 "Best of the Blues" (BB) Awards by The Washington Blues Society, managing to win in five categories during the recent awards finals. Those awards include "Best Electric Guitar" (Tom "T-Boy Neal" Boyle); "Best Blues Horn" (saxman Jim King); "Best Bass" (upright specialist Les White); "Keeping the Blues Alive" (drummer Jeff Hayes); and most importantly, "BEST BLUES BAND of 2006"! The "Best Band" award earns Becki Sue & her Big Rockin' Daddies! a spot at the Blues Foundation's 23rd Annual International Blues Challenge in Memphis in February of 2007, representing The Washington Blues Society!
